Giải Phương Trình Bậc 2 Bằng Mã Giả

Giải Phương Trình Bậc 2 Bằng Mã Giả là một kỹ năng lập trình cơ bản và quan trọng. Bài viết này sẽ hướng dẫn bạn cách viết mã giả để giải phương trình bậc 2, cùng với những phân tích chi tiết và ví dụ minh họa.

Hiểu Về Phương Trình Bậc 2 và Mã Giả

Phương trình bậc 2 có dạng ax² + bx + c = 0, với a, b, và c là các hệ số. Mã giả là một dạng miêu tả thuật toán lập trình, sử dụng ngôn ngữ tự nhiên, dễ hiểu, không phụ thuộc vào bất kỳ ngôn ngữ lập trình cụ thể nào. Viết mã giả giúp chúng ta phác thảo logic giải quyết vấn đề trước khi chuyển sang code thực tế.

Xây Dựng Mã Giả cho Giải Phương Trình Bậc 2

Dưới đây là mã giả để giải phương trình bậc 2:

  1. Nhập các hệ số a, b, và c.
  2. Tính delta (Δ): Δ = b² – 4ac
  3. Kiểm tra delta:
    • Nếu Δ > 0: Phương trình có hai nghiệm phân biệt:
      • x1 = (-b + √Δ) / 2a
      • x2 = (-b – √Δ) / 2a
    • Nếu Δ = 0: Phương trình có nghiệm kép:
      • x = -b / 2a
    • Nếu Δ < 0: Phương trình vô nghiệm.
  4. Xuất kết quả.

Ví Dụ Minh Họa Giải Phương Trình Bậc 2 Bằng Mã Giả

Giả sử ta có phương trình x² – 4x + 3 = 0. Áp dụng mã giả:

  1. a = 1, b = -4, c = 3
  2. Δ = (-4)² – 4 1 3 = 4
  3. Vì Δ > 0, phương trình có hai nghiệm phân biệt:
    • x1 = (4 + √4) / 2 = 3
    • x2 = (4 – √4) / 2 = 1

Vậy nghiệm của phương trình là x1 = 3 và x2 = 1.

Ứng Dụng của Giải Phương Trình Bậc 2

Giải phương trình bậc 2 có nhiều ứng dụng trong thực tế, từ tính toán vật lý, luyện tập giải bài toán bằng cách lập phương trình đến thiết kế đồ họa và game nhẹ giải trí. Việc nắm vững cách giải phương trình bậc 2 bằng mã giả là bước đệm quan trọng để xây dựng các chương trình phức tạp hơn. giải phương trình bậc 2 trên c++ cũng là một kỹ năng hữu ích.

Lời khuyên từ chuyên gia

Nguyễn Văn A, chuyên gia lập trình tại Đại học Bách Khoa Hà Nội, cho biết: “Việc luyện tập viết mã giả thường xuyên sẽ giúp bạn nâng cao khả năng tư duy logic và giải quyết vấn đề.”

Kết luận

Giải phương trình bậc 2 bằng mã giả là một kỹ năng quan trọng trong lập trình. Bài viết này đã cung cấp cho bạn kiến thức cơ bản và ví dụ minh họa. Hy vọng bạn sẽ áp dụng những kiến thức này vào thực tế. công thức giải nhanh cực trị hàm bậc 3 cũng là một chủ đề thú vị để tìm hiểu thêm.

FAQ

  1. Mã giả là gì?
  2. Tại sao cần viết mã giả trước khi lập trình?
  3. Delta là gì trong phương trình bậc 2?
  4. Phương trình bậc 2 có bao nhiêu nghiệm?
  5. Làm thế nào để kiểm tra nghiệm của phương trình bậc 2?
  6. Ứng dụng của phương trình bậc 2 trong thực tế là gì?
  7. Tôi có thể tìm thêm tài liệu về giải phương trình bậc 2 ở đâu?

Mô tả các tình huống thường gặp câu hỏi

Người dùng thường tìm kiếm cách giải phương trình bậc 2 bằng mã giả khi họ đang học lập trình, làm bài tập về nhà, hoặc cần áp dụng vào dự án thực tế. Họ có thể gặp khó khăn trong việc chuyển đổi công thức toán học sang mã giả hoặc xử lý các trường hợp đặc biệt như delta âm.

Gợi ý các câu hỏi khác, bài viết khác có trong web.

Bạn có thể tìm hiểu thêm về nước uống giải cảm trên website của chúng tôi.

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*